Tenshades:
Blame it on the society we are in.

The analogic old folks and educated illiterates believe you must have grey hair or struggle for ages like your predecessors before you become rich/wealthy legally.

Envy and hate brew in such people when they see a young fella prosper in the society.

They look for ways to bring that person down, spite and badmouth him/her as long as they feel he/she has to reach a 'certain' old age before 'doing well' in life.

Some people will be like 'when dem born am sef wey him don dey get dat kind money?' grin

Same way they believe anyone who doesn't go out in the morning at 4am and comes back at 11pm daily is into fraud.

They are not exposed to the opportunities on the 'net' so they'll find it strange that young professionals like programmers, animators, copywriters, SEO experts, video editors, online tutors, CPA marketers, Crypto/Forex traders amongst others are cashing out thousands of dollars monthly without stepping out of their homes.
